Senior CAD Engineer – Closures Systems
Experience : 8 Years
Location: Southfield, MI
Schedule: Monday–Friday, 9:00 AM – 6:00 PM EDT
Workplace Type: Onsite
Key Responsibilities
- Lead design and development of closure components and systems, including hood, fender, side door, decklid/liftgate, trim, spoilers, claddings, reinforcements, and brackets.
- Manage CAD modeling, packaging layouts, and detailed part/assembly drawings using CATIA V5/V6 or 3DX.
- Ensure all closure systems meet functional, performance, cost, manufacturability, and serviceability requirements.
- Apply GD&T principles, design for manufacturability/assembly (DFM/DFA), and support design release activities.
- Collaborate cross-functionally with CAE, manufacturing, and stamping/supplier engineering teams to optimize designs.
- Interpret simulation and analysis results to guide design iterations and improve performance.
- Participate in benchmarking and competitive analysis to assess design competitiveness.
- Support prototype builds, testing, and validation of closure system components.
- Contribute to continuous improvement and maintain alignment with safety and regulatory standards.
